Understanding Data Models in DMPs
The Undergraduate Certificate in Building and Optimizing Data Models in DMPs focuses on the development of data models that can be used to manage and analyze large datasets. Students learn how to design and implement data models that can handle complex data structures, ensuring that data is accurately collected, stored, and analyzed. A key aspect of this certificate is its emphasis on practical applications, with students working on real-world case studies to develop their skills in data modeling, data warehousing, and data governance. For instance, a case study on a retail company's customer segmentation project can help students understand how to design a data model that captures customer behavior, preferences, and demographics, enabling targeted marketing campaigns and improved customer engagement.

Optimizing Data Models for Business Success
A critical aspect of the Undergraduate Certificate in Building and Optimizing Data Models in DMPs is its focus on optimizing data models for business success. Students learn how to evaluate the effectiveness of data models, identify areas for improvement, and implement changes to optimize performance. This involves developing skills in data quality management, data governance, and data security, ensuring that data models are aligned with organizational goals and objectives. For instance, a case study on a manufacturing company's supply chain optimization project can help students understand how to design a data model that captures supply chain data, enabling real-time monitoring and optimization of supply chain operations.
